Responsibilities
  • Psychosocial Assessment to be completed in a timely manner using theoretical knowledge of human behavior and psychosocial factors affecting treatment outcomes, and understanding ethical/risk issues
  • Clinical intervention including supportive counseling with patients and families, linkage and referral to community agencies and services, facilitating family conferences, helping families cope with difficult decisions (e.g., hospice, DNR, placement), assisting families with communicating concerns to patient’s physicians, and collaborating with Case Managers on discharge planning; provide group facilitation and program development.
  • Triage/Management of clinical caseload demonstrating ability to identify high-risk situations, effectively manage caseload, balance referrals, high-risk admissions, and ongoing patient care; request assistance as needed
  • Incorporation of legal and ethical standards into all clinical assessments and interventions (e.g., suspected abuse or neglect, Tarasoff duty to warn, conservatorship, patient rights); adherence to Tenet Policies, Procedures and Practices in Social Services
  • Documentation completed per policy (Interdisciplinary Plan of Care, Education Form, Advance Health Care Directive follow up form and Social Services Progress Notes)
  • In-service education for other hospital staff regarding psychosocial issues of patient care (e.g., Lunch and Learns)
  • Social Service reports provided in a timely manner (e.g., PAS numbers, case assignment by Social Worker, Absence Approval requests)
  • Quality Improvement participation in development, monitoring and analysis of process and outcome indicators for improvement of patient care
  • Maintains competencies for hospital, age-specific and job-specific standards of care
  • Other duties as assigned (this can include Social Work Month activities, cancer-specific support groups and educational programs for patients, families, staff and volunteers)
